How mover licensing works in Nevada

A move that crosses state lines is regulated federally by the FMCSA, and every legitimate interstate mover has a USDOT number you can confirm at safer.fmcsa.dot.gov. A move that stays inside Nevada is regulated by the state. In Nevada that is the Nevada Transportation Authority (NTA), which issues a state mover license or registration you can verify directly.
